2. Is electronic signature legal?
Yes, it is completely legal. After ESIGN Act released in 2000, an electronic signature is considered like physical one is. You are able to fill out a word file and sign it, and to official establishments it will be the same as if you signed a hard copy with pen, old-fashioned.
